uPVC windows can have problems opening or locking. This is usually the case when the locking system is stiff or sluggish. If this is the case, an easy solution is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to make sure that the lock's handle is lubricated and the lock mechanism. This will allow the mechanism to free up and the window or door to operate normally once more.
The hinges can be stiff or stuck. This issue is typically caused by dust and grit that build up on the hinges over time. The solution is to grease the hinges with oil or grease. Using the wrong type of grease, however, could lead to damage and Upvc repairs may render the hinges inoperable.

Stained Glass Repairs
Stained glass windows can be found in churches, homes and other structures. They provide visual interest, privacy and light the space. However, they can be quite fragile and need to be carefully maintained to keep them in good working order. Even with the best care stained glass and leaded windows will deteriorate due to age, exposure to the elements and weather factors. This causes a range of issues like cracks, fade and water leakage. If you own stained or leaded glass window that requires repair, it is essential to find an expert in your area who can restore the piece to its original splendor.
On average, the cost for repair of broken or cracked stained glass is around $500. The cost will differ based on the method required to fix the problem. For example professionals may employ cop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ing to fix the damaged glass. They can also relead lead cames and repair stained glass. There are many options to choose from and each one has its own benefits and costs. The selection of the most suitable option will be determined by the size of the crack, the location and the kind of material used to create the glass.
Cracks in the leaded glass could be caused by thermal expansion or vibrations, or contraction and building movements, or normal wear and tear. Over time, the cracks could grow and cause more problems. To avoid further damage and expansion any crack that crosses the face of stained-glass panels or their face must be fixed as fast as possible. In the past, this was typically accomplished by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ange over the crack. This was a poor method of repair and is no longer the case. There are better methods of fixing cracks of this type.
Stained glass restoration can take on various forms. It can be as easy as repairing a chip, Upvc repairs or as complex as making the stained glass door panel or window to its original condition. In general, the price of a full restoration is higher than a simple repair. This is due to the fact that the process involves cleaning and removing damaged or stained glass, tightening the lead cames, sealing and re-tying cement and replacing any missing pieces of stained glass.
Weatherstripping Repairs
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through gaps around windows and doors. It's an essential part of home maintenance and can reduce the need for expensive repairs or bills for energy, as well making a home more comfortable. The materials used to create the seal may degrade over time, due to wear and tear. It is crucial to replace these materials regularly.
You can detect whether your weather stripping has been damaged by noticing a damp spot after washing the windows, a whistling sound when driving, or a draft that you can feel inside a closed-door. All of these are indicators to locate a Tasker near me who offers weatherstripping repairs.
Taskers can seal your windows and door with a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made of closed or open-cell foam and are available in a variety of thicknesses, widths, and quality to accommodate all kinds of cracks. They are easy to install and can be easily cut by cutting. Felt strips are also affordable and usually last for a year or two. They can be cut to size using scissors, and attach them to the frame of your door, hinge side, or sliding windows using glue, staples or tacks. Vinyl or metal V strips are a bit more difficult to install, but can be nailed along the window jamb.
